Your Money Team: Why the Wealthy Never Go It Alone with Tyler Osborne

What if money’s real job is to give you choices?

That’s where this conversation starts. Dr. Felecia Froe sits down with Tyler Osborne, financial educator, public speaker, host of the Money Master Podcast, and owner of a financial firm focused on helping people build wealth through structure, retirement planning, and legacy strategies. With experience at JPMorgan, a background in psychology, time spent in Bible college, and the discipline of a former college football player, Tyler brings a grounded approach to money that integrates mindset, faith, family, and long-term financial planning.

Dr. Felecia leads the conversation through the questions many people are afraid to ask out loud: Where did your money story begin? What does financial literacy actually mean? How do you walk away from a steady income when you know there is something more? And why do so many of us have pieces of a plan, but not a full financial foundation? Together, they talk about building wealth with intention, protecting what you build, and creating a team that helps you make smarter decisions.
